diff options
| author | michael pereira | 2011-03-09 20:53:33 +0100 |
|---|---|---|
| committer | michael pereira | 2011-03-09 20:53:33 +0100 |
| commit | 67a08738a5f688f1050b83572a717c727e7d29c3 (patch) | |
| tree | 04eb412293dbcd7b645fc52d615413e22bbb3d89 /application/forms/BootmenuEntriesEdit.php | |
| parent | Controller Validation fix (diff) | |
| download | pbs2-67a08738a5f688f1050b83572a717c727e7d29c3.tar.gz pbs2-67a08738a5f688f1050b83572a717c727e7d29c3.tar.xz pbs2-67a08738a5f688f1050b83572a717c727e7d29c3.zip | |
KCL und BootMenuFilter
Diffstat (limited to 'application/forms/BootmenuEntriesEdit.php')
| -rw-r--r-- | application/forms/BootmenuEntriesEdit.php | 11 |
1 files changed, 10 insertions, 1 deletions
diff --git a/application/forms/BootmenuEntriesEdit.php b/application/forms/BootmenuEntriesEdit.php index 7fd97fe..8eb4b95 100644 --- a/application/forms/BootmenuEntriesEdit.php +++ b/application/forms/BootmenuEntriesEdit.php @@ -24,6 +24,12 @@ class Application_Form_BootmenuEntriesEdit extends Zend_Form public function init() { + + if(!isset($_POST['bootosID'])){ + $firstbootos = array_slice($this->bootoslist,0,1); + $_POST['bootosID'] = $firstbootos[0]->getID(); + } + $this->setName("BootMenuEntryAdd"); $this->setMethod('post'); @@ -37,7 +43,9 @@ class Application_Form_BootmenuEntriesEdit extends Zend_Form )); $bootosfield = $this->createElement('select','bootosID'); - $bootosfield ->setLabel('BootOs:'); + $bootosfield->setLabel('BootOs:'); + $bootosfield->setAttrib('onChange', "document.getElementById('BootMenuEntryAdd').submit();"); + if(count($this->bootoslist)>0){ foreach($this->bootoslist as $bootos => $b){ @@ -56,6 +64,7 @@ class Application_Form_BootmenuEntriesEdit extends Zend_Form 'cols' => 50, 'rows' => 5, 'label' => 'KCL:', + 'value' => $this->bootoslist[$_POST['bootosID']]->getDefaultkcl() )); $configfield = $this->createElement('select','configID'); |
